San Francisco becomes highest-income big US metro area

Posted online

San Francisco edged out Washington, D.C., last year as the highest-earning large U.S. metropolitan area.

The San Francisco metro area's median household income last year was $96,667. That's ahead of the $95,843 figure for the nation's capital.

The median income for the San Francisco area rose by 9.2 percent last year.
